
This is the Magic ($5.50) from Bear Espresso Bar. A Magic is an espresso-based drink invented in Melbourne, prepared with a double ristretto shot topped with steamed milk and traditionally served in a 150 mL cup.
The beverage presented with a warm medium brown hue beneath a fine layer of glossy microfoam. Aroma opened with prominent notes of fruity dark chocolate, characteristic of the Flour Mill blend from Headlands Coffee.
Initial contact delivered immediate cocoa notes reminiscent of high-quality fruity dark chocolate, carried by the concentrated ristretto extraction. The steamed milk rounded the body without masking the coffee, producing a smooth, velvety mouthfeel that recalled dark chocolate melted into a rich hot chocolate-coffee hybrid.
Through the mid-palate, the milk integrated seamlessly with the espresso, softening the intensity while preserving the blend’s distinctive fruit character. As the cocoa notes gradually receded, subtle strawberry-like sweetness emerged, lending brightness without introducing noticeable acidity. The shortened ristretto extraction successfully avoided bitterness, allowing the sweeter, fruit-forward characteristics of the coffee to remain clearly defined despite the milk.
Towards the finish, the cocoa and strawberry notes lingered together in balanced proportion, resolving into a clean, smooth aftertaste free from bitterness or sourness. Sitting comfortably between the strength of a piccolo and the softness of a flat white, the Magic delivered an exceptionally well-balanced expression of the coffee’s flavour profile.
Overall, a milk-based espresso beverage with a layered flavour trajectory and seamless textural integration, resulting in a remarkably balanced and expressive cup.
